Premiering in Sydney and concurrent with the popular light festival, Vivid Sydney, the 2022 O-Show from 27-28 May is aspiring to be bigger and better than ever before.
“Vibrant Sydney will not disappoint this May when O-Show opens its doors in this beautiful city for the first time,” said Optical Distributors & Manufacturers Association’s (ODMA) CEO Finola Carey. “It will be the first regional live optical event staged for years. Equally, it will be the first spring buying-focused trade fair and the first time masterclasses and workshops will run in conjunction with the O-Show. With more exhibition booths than ever before, we will see the floor packed with new products and services.”
The 100-plus booths will showcase lenses, frames, equipment demonstrations and a whole lot of fashion and fun from over 60 leading optical suppliers, Carey said. Free Spotlight sessions presenting fashion ideas, business tips and new product information will run daily, while the masterclass stream (fees apply) will run alongside the trade floor, offering tips and tools for dispensing and essential skills for optical retail staff.
Hosted at The Hordern Pavilion in Sydney’s Moore Park, ODMA is encouraging O-Show visitors to join their peers at the happy hour event at 5pm on Friday 27 May.
